An autopsy performed on a Notre Dame student who died in his dorm room earlier this week was inconclusive.
Jake Scanlan, a mechanical engineering student from North Potomac, Md., died in his Siegfried Hall dorm room Wednesday morning, Nov. 11.

The preliminary report from the autopsy performed Thursday, Nov. 12, showed Scanlan had an enlarged heart, but no cause of death was determined, the South Bend Tribune reported.
A full autopsy report will be available in the next few weeks. Toxicology results can take up to 12 weeks.
